Multi-tenant ERP versus dedicated architecture in logistics environments
The multi-tenant ERP decision is central to logistics subscription platform design. Multi-tenant architecture is usually the right starting point for standardized workflows such as shipment booking, order orchestration, customer self-service, recurring invoicing, proof-of-delivery visibility, and partner portal access. It improves infrastructure efficiency, accelerates onboarding, simplifies release management, and supports stronger recurring revenue margins. However, logistics businesses often include customers with specialized routing logic, custom carrier integrations, unique compliance requirements, or region-specific tax and documentation rules. Those cases may justify dedicated environments.
| Architecture Model | Best Fit | Commercial Advantage | Operational Trade-Off |
|---|---|---|---|
| Shared multi-tenant Odoo SaaS | Standardized logistics subscriptions with similar workflows | Higher margin, faster onboarding, simpler upgrades | Requires strict governance over customization and resource allocation |
| Segmented multi-tenant clusters | Regional, vertical, or service-tier separation | Balances efficiency with better performance isolation | More complex environment management than a single shared stack |
| Dedicated single-tenant hosting | Large accounts with custom integrations or compliance demands | Premium pricing and stronger enterprise positioning | Higher infrastructure cost and slower release standardization |
A practical strategy is to begin with a controlled multi-tenant core and define explicit migration paths to dedicated hosting for high-volume or high-complexity customers. This preserves standardization for most subscribers while allowing enterprise expansion without replatforming. In logistics, where transaction spikes may be seasonal or event-driven, segmented multi-tenant clusters can also reduce noisy-neighbor risk while maintaining operational efficiency.
Infrastructure design for high-volume transaction scale
Odoo hosting for logistics SaaS must be engineered around sustained throughput, not just average usage. High-volume transaction scale introduces pressure on application workers, PostgreSQL performance, queue handling, storage IOPS, backup windows, API rate management, and observability. A resilient cloud ERP hosting model should include workload-aware sizing, horizontal scaling where appropriate, queue separation for asynchronous jobs, database tuning, caching strategy, and environment-level monitoring tied to service thresholds.

That means defining infrastructure classes by transaction profile, integration intensity, storage growth, and recovery objectives. Logistics customers often underestimate the impact of barcode operations, mobile updates, EDI exchanges, webhook bursts, and customer portal traffic on platform stability. Managed hosting should therefore include performance baselining, capacity planning, patch governance, backup validation, disaster recovery procedures, and escalation workflows.
- Use infrastructure-based pricing tiers tied to transaction volume, integration load, storage, and service-level expectations rather than user count alone.
- Separate production, staging, and support operations with clear release controls to reduce disruption during high-volume periods.
- Implement monitoring for database latency, queue backlog, worker utilization, API failures, and storage growth to detect scale issues early.
- Design backup and recovery policies around logistics recovery tolerance, especially for shipment events, billing records, and warehouse transactions.
- Reserve dedicated hosting for customers with custom code intensity, strict compliance requirements, or premium uptime commitments.

Governance, onboarding, and customer success at scale
High-volume logistics SaaS fails more often from weak governance than from software limitations. Governance should cover tenant provisioning, customization approval, release management, security controls, backup policy, integration certification, support triage, and data retention. In a multi-tenant ERP model, governance is what preserves margin and service quality. Without it, one customer or partner can introduce instability that affects the wider platform.
Onboarding should be productized. That means predefined implementation tracks for standard logistics operators, advanced operators, and enterprise accounts. Data migration, process mapping, user training, and go-live readiness should follow repeatable checkpoints. Customer success should then focus on adoption, transaction health, billing accuracy, support trends, and expansion opportunities. In subscription businesses, retention is operational. If shipment workflows are stable, invoices are accurate, and support response is consistent, recurring revenue becomes more durable.
- Establish architecture review gates before approving custom modules, third-party integrations, or premium hosting exceptions.
- Define tenant lifecycle controls for provisioning, upgrades, archival, and recovery to reduce unmanaged operational sprawl.
- Use customer success metrics tied to transaction stability, support volume, onboarding completion, and renewal risk.
- Create partner governance tiers so only qualified partners can sell or implement higher-complexity logistics environments.
- Maintain a documented release calendar with rollback procedures for peak logistics periods and critical billing windows.
